Chrome Gas Cap Question
Hi there yesterday at about 5-6pm i put on my chrome gas cap held on with 3m tape. Just wondering is it okay to drive the car now its been like 18hours but it been raining for the last 8 hours. Do u think it bonded enough. Thanks

It really doesn't bond much more by sitting, I'd imagine that you would have the same amount of hold now as you did when you put it on, as long as the surface was clean and dry.
